The World Blogger Championship of Online Poker PDF Print E-mail
Written by 72os Team   
The World Blogger Championship of Online Poker is back!

Calling all bloggers - it’s time once again for the annual PokerStars World Blogger Championship of Online Poker! If you play poker and have your own blog, the 2008 WBCOOP is the perfect tournament series for you. This is the event that gives bloggers from across the globe the chance to face off against each other for FREE, win great prizes and battle for the coveted title!

Registration for WBCOOP will end December 20, 06:00 ET. To keep up to date with everything that is happening with the 2008 WBCOOP, including news and tournament reports from the seven event series, check out the PokerStars Blog.
More Ways to Win

This year we are giving you more chances than ever before to get in on the action. Simply register your blog and you can play in our Freeroll qualifiers, and be in with a shot at winning great prizes and WBCOOP Final seats. Make it to the Final and you’ll have the chance to play for a PokerStars Caribbean Adventure prize package worth $14,300 and European Poker Tour event packages worth $7,500. We’ll also be giving away free entries into our biggest online tournaments and Steps satellite tickets. In total, we’re paying out $100,000 worth of prizes! See below to find out more about what you can win.

The WBCOOP is open EXCLUSIVELY to anyone with an eligible blog site. Once you have registered, you can use your blog to tell all your readers that you’ll be playing in the event - and write a report afterwards about how you took it down! It doesn’t even matter if your blog isn’t about poker - you can still enter. We are running daily Freeroll qualifiers in a range of poker games - open to all registered and verified bloggers. If you’re new to poker, check out our Poker Games page to learn the rules and get some helpful tips.
How to Play

For your blog to be eligible, it must have been online for at least two months and updated on a regular basis. Blogs created specifically for this promotion, or that only have a few posts, will not be granted entry to WBCOOP. If you have been eligible in the past for WBCCOP but have not updated your blog on a regular basis since the last event, you will not be eligible to play. All decisions about eligibility rest with WBCOOP management and are final.

Visit the registration page to find out how to submit your blog for verification, and get your entry ticket to the freeroll qualifiers.
Freeroll Qualifiers

The daily Freerolls run from December 15-20 2008, in a range of different poker games. See below for more details and prize information. You can find these events listed in the PokerStars lobby, under the 'Events' and 'Special' tab.

WBCOOP 2007

Last year’s event saw more than 1,300 players gather from around the world to compete for the Championship. Portugal’s LParreira walked away the big winner -taking first place and a PokerStars Caribbean Adventure seat worth $12,000! Visit the PokerStars Blog to read a full report of all the action from 2007 and other previous years.
